Insomnia Cookies is a dynamic bakery and delivery company founded 20 years ago by Seth Berkowitz with humble beginnings in a college dorm room. The company has grown into a beloved cult brand famous for delivering warm, delicious cookies throughout the day and late into the night. Today, Insomnia Cookies boasts a global presence with over 300 stores, an experiential flagship bakery in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, and an expanding nationwide shipping and gifting portfolio. This innovative bakery and delivery concept combines quality bakery products with exceptional customer service to create a unique sweet-easy experience for cookie lovers everywhere. Insomnia Cookies emphasizes continuous growth, operational excellence, and a vibrant team culture that supports both personal and professional development. The Richmond, Virginia location at 918 W Grace St is one of the company’s key locations where this mission comes to life.

The Assistant Bakery Operations Manager (ABOM) role at Insomnia Cookies is a specialized leadership pipeline designed to develop future Bakery Operations Managers by giving them hands-on operational ownership, leadership experience, and administrative responsibilities. ABOMs work alongside the Bakery Operations Manager (BOM) to execute all bakery operations with urgency, accuracy, and accountability, gaining skills to independently manage a bakery. This role blends operational discipline, team development, and administrative execution, perfectly positioning a rising leader to step into full bakery management. Key to success in this role are executing inventory management, scheduling, staffing coordination, food safety standards, and guest experience excellence while also developing and coaching the bakery team.

Job Duties

  • Execute all core bakery operations including inventory rotation, scheduling support, staffing coordination, and administrative checklists
  • Maintain strict adherence to product quality, cleanliness, food safety, and guest experience standards
  • Support ordering, inventory accuracy, and shrink control
  • Assist in schedule creation and labor execution to meet operational targets
  • Support recruiting, interviewing, onboarding, and training of new staff
  • Deliver consistent coaching and real-time performance feedback
  • Hold team members accountable to standards while reinforcing a growth mindset culture
  • Ensure onboarding and training programs are executed to company standards
  • Manage bakery operations independently in the absence of the BOM
  • Model urgency, accountability, and operational discipline
  • Partner with BOM and Area leadership to identify operational gaps and implement solutions
  • Maintain continuity of operations during leadership transitions or staffing shortages
